Property — Parametric form

A line through the point S0\vec S_0 with direction vector v\vec v is written S=S0+vt\vec S = \vec S_0 + \vec v\,t, that is {x=x0+vxty=y0+vytz=z0+vzt,tR.\begin{cases} x = x_0+v_x t \\ y = y_0+v_y t \\ z = z_0+v_z t \end{cases}, \qquad t\in\mathbb{R}. The vector v\vec v is the “velocity” of the line: as the parameter tt varies the point S\vec S traces out the line.
